English:
Divje Babe flute (alleged Late Pleistocene flute) dating to 43100 ± 700 BP. National Museum of Slovenia. Measurements: 133.6 mm (5.26 in) long
Español:
La flauta de Divje Babe es un fémur de oso de las cavernas perforado por agujeros espaciados que se encontró en 1995 en el parque arqueológico Divje Babe, ubicado cerca de Cerkno en el noroeste de Eslovenia.
